Dear PVUSD Families and Staff,
We are pleased to share an important update regarding our Summer Programming registration process.
PVUSD is currently revamping summer registration to create one streamlinedunified system that will allow families to complete registration more quickly and efficiently through a single portal for both Summer School and Summer Camp programs.
This updated process is designed to improve accessibility, reduce confusion, and provide a smoother experience for families as they plan for summer learning and enrichment opportunities.
 
Upcoming Timeline:
Mid–Late March: Registration for Summer School and Summer Camps will open via InPlay. Look out for a text message with your personalized invitation 

Get ready for a summer full of learning, laughter, and new adventures! This year’s Summer School program is bigger and brighter than ever!
 
Our elementary students will enjoy engaging, hands-on learning at five elementary school sites, including a special Bridge Dual Language Program at HA Hyde—a perfect opportunity to build skills and confidence in a fun, supportive environment.
 
Summer School programming will run 6.5 hours per day. Additional Breakfast Club and After School programming to create a 7–9 hour day. Transportation, breakfast, lunch, and an afternoon snack will be provided to ensure students are supported throughout the day.
 
Students will engage in reading, math, and fun science projects designed to spark curiosity and strengthen foundational skills. We will also welcome various community partners to our campuses to provide fun and enriching activities that make learning exciting and memorable!
 
All middle school students will come together at Cesar Chavez Middle School, where learning meets connection, creativity, and community.
 
Watsonville High will host all high school students and our promoting 8th grade students—can explore exciting new courses designed to spark curiosity and expand interests. Whether you're discovering a new passion or getting ahead for the fall, there’s something for everyone! Need to make up credits? We have you covered! Students are able to makeup up to two classes!
 
And that’s not all… Cabrillo College will be on campus offering Yoga! What better way to balance brainpower with relaxation and wellness than with dual enrollment.
 
This summer, we’re bringing together opportunity, enrichment, and fun. Each student is allowed to enroll in Summer School and two Summer Camps during the first round of enrollments!
